TWICE - What Is Love?

"What is Love?" is a popular song by the South Korean girl group TWICE. Here are some interesting facts about the song and the group:

  1. Release Date: "What is Love?" was released on April 9, 2018, as the title track of TWICE's fifth extended play (EP) of the same name.

  2. Genre: The song is known for its catchy and upbeat pop sound, which is a signature style of TWICE.

  3. Music Video: The music video for "What is Love?" features the members of TWICE recreating iconic scenes from popular movies and TV shows, such as "Pulp Fiction," "Ghost," and "La La Land." It garnered a lot of attention for its creativity and references.

  4. Chart Success: The song was a commercial success, topping various music charts in South Korea and achieving high chart positions in several other countries. It also earned TWICE several music show wins.

  5. Lyrics: The lyrics of "What is Love?" explore the theme of love and curiosity about different aspects of it. The song expresses the idea that love can be found in various forms, like the love seen in movies.

  6. Global Popularity: TWICE is known for their global popularity, and "What is Love?" contributed to their growing international fanbase. The song's catchy melody and relatable lyrics resonated with fans worldwide.

  7. TWICE: TWICE is a nine-member girl group formed by JYP Entertainment. They have become one of the leading K-pop girl groups known for their vibrant music, charming personalities, and strong presence in both South Korea and international markets.

  8. Awards and Achievements: "What is Love?" received recognition at various music award ceremonies and became one of TWICE's iconic songs, solidifying their status in the K-pop industry.

"What is Love?" is a significant song in TWICE's discography, known for its catchy tune, creative music video, and its contribution to the group's success in the K-pop industry.
